Psychological Developments in High Technology Teaching and Learning Environments.
Morgan, Konrad; Morgan, Madeleine; Hall, John
British Journal of Educational Technology, v31 n1 p71-79 Jan 2000
Discussion of psychological effects associated with the increasing capabilities of new technology focuses on issues involved with multimedia teaching systems and the development of the self. Includes a review of technology attitudes and individual differences in relation to the voluntary use of technology and contrasts that with the rejection of technology. (Author/LRW)
